Safety Evaluation
The NRC staff reviewed the St. Lucie Plant, Units 1 and 2, subsequent license renewal application for compliance with the requirements of Title 10 of the Code of Federal Regulations, Part 54, "Requirements for Renewal of Operating Licenses for Nuclear Power Plants" and prepared a safety evaluation to document its findings. The "Safety Evaluation Related to the SLRA of St. Lucie Plant, Units 1 and 2," was issued on July 21, 2023. Revision 1 "St. Lucie SLRA SER Rev 1" was issued on September 1, 2023.
Environmental Review
Generic Environmental Impact Statement for License Renewal of Nuclear Plants, Supplement 11, Second Renewal, Regarding Subsequent License Renewal for St. Lucie Plant, Units 1 and 2, Draft Report for Comment, was published December 2025. The NRC prepared this supplemental environmental impact statement in response to the application submitted by Florida Power & Light Company to subsequently renew the renewed facility operating licenses for St. Lucie Plant, Units 1 and 2, for an additional 20 years. The supplemental environmental impact statement, in combination with the Commission’s NUREG-1437, Generic Environmental Impact Statement for License Renewal of Nuclear Plants, evaluates the environmental impacts of the proposed action and includes an analysis of any negative environmental impacts of not implementing the proposed action. The NRC staff’s preliminary recommendation is that the adverse environmental impacts of subsequent license renewal for St. Lucie Plant, Units 1 and 2, are not so great that preserving the option of subsequent license renewal for energy-planning decision makers would be unreasonable.
